What is an outbound logistics manager?

Outbound Logistics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ing the distribution and transportation of goods from a company to its customers or distribution centers. They ensure that products are shipped efficiently, on time, and in good condition, while also managing inventory, coordinating with carriers, and optimizing logistics processes. Their role is crucial in maintaining customer satisfaction and reducing transportation costs. Outbound Logistics Managers often collaborate with other departments such as sales, production, and warehousing to streamline operations and improve overall supply chain performance.

How does an outbound logistics manager typically collaborate with other departments to ensure timely delivery of goods?

An Outbound Logistics Manager works closely with departments such as sales, production, and customer service to coordinate the dispatch and delivery of goods. They regularly communicate with warehouse teams to track inventory levels, update shipment schedules, and resolve any logistical bottlenecks. Collaboration with transportation providers and IT staff is also essential to maintain efficient, real-time tracking systems. This cross-functional teamwork helps ensure that customers receive their orders on time and that any issues are quickly addressed.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an outbound logistics man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Outbound Logistics Manager, you need expertise in supply chain management, inventory control, and transportation logistics, often supported by a relevant degree or certification such as APICS or CSCMP. Familiarity with warehouse management systems (WMS), transportation management systems (TMS), and ERP software is typically required. Exceptional organizational skills,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ication are crucial soft skills in this role. These skills ensure efficient product delivery, cost control, and customer satisfaction in a dynamic logistics environment.

What is the difference between Outbound Logistics Manager vs Warehouse Supervisor?

AspectOutbound Logistics ManagerWarehouse Supervisor
Primary FocusOversees transportation, distribution, and delivery of goods to customersManages daily warehouse operations and staff
ResponsibilitiesPlanning logistics, optimizing routes, coordinating with carriersInventory management, staff supervision, ensuring safety
CredentialsBachelor's in logistics, supply chain, or related field; certifications like CSCPHigh school diploma or equivalent; experience in warehouse operations
Work EnvironmentOffice-based with site visits to warehouses and transportation hubsWarehouse setting, physically active role

The Outbound Logistics Manager focuses on coordinating the movement of goods from warehouses to customers, requiring logistics expertise and planning skills. In contrast, the Warehouse Supervisor manages daily warehouse activities and staff. Both roles are essential in supply chain operations but differ in scope and responsibilities.

Job description

The Facility Manager is responsible for the overall leadership, operational performance, and regulatory compliance of Patriot Environmental's Portland waste treatment, disposal, and wastewater pre-treatment facility. This role holds full P&L accountability and leads all site functions-including operations, maintenance, logistics, laboratory, and safety-to ensure efficient, compliant, and profitable operations.
The Facility Manager oversees a multi-functional team in a regulated industrial environment and is responsible for optimizing throughput, maintaining compliance, and driving continuous improvement across all aspects of facility performance.
Essential Functions
Operations & Site Leadership
  • Lead daily operations across processing, maintenance, logistics, laboratory, and administrative functions
  • Direct and optimize waste treatment and processing activities
  • Oversee inbound and outbound logistics including scheduling of tankers, railcars, and trailers
  • Ensure efficient coordination of receiving, storage, processing, and outbound shipments
  • Utilize CMMS systems to ensure reliability and maintenance of facility assets

Safety & Compliance
  • Champion a strong safety culture and ensure adherence to safety policies and procedures
  • Maintain compliance with RCRA, CWA, EPA, DOT, OSHA regulations
  • Manage permits and regulatory obligations; lead inspections and permit renewals
  • Ensure accurate regulatory reporting and documentation

Financial & Business Performance
  • Own facility P&L, cost controls, and budget performance
  • Partner with sales teams to support growth and profitability
  • Identify opportunities to improve throughput and operational efficiency
  • Oversee inventory management and third-party vendor coordination

People Leadership
  • Lead and develop cross-functional teams
  • Set performance expectations and drive accountability
  • Develop SOPs and lead training programs
  • Foster a culture of safety and continuous improvement

Reporting & Coordination
  • Provide regular updates to senior leadership
  • Partner with corporate functions across operations, finance, and compliance
  • Oversee vendor and contractor performance

Education & Essential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in engineering or physical sciences is highly preferred
  • High school diploma or equivalent required
  • 7+ years in industrial waste processing, environmental services and/or related industries
  • Progressive leadership experience
  • P&L management experience
  • Knowledge of waste treatment, wastewater pre-treatment, and regulatory frameworks including but not limited to RCRA, CWA, EPA, DOT, OSHA.
  • Experience with plant operations, maintenance, and permitting
  • Logistics experience (tankers, rail, or other bulk transport)

Core Competencies
  • Strong operational leadership and process management
  • Ability to improve efficiency and solve complex problems
  • Effective team leadership and communication skills
  • Ability to operate in a regulated, safety-critical environment
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office and CMMS systems

Work Environment
Combination of indoor and outdoor industrial work with physical activity including walking, climbing, and lifting up to 50 pounds.
